Aventa Learning Teacher Position
Description:
This position will support the Aventa Learning curriculum and students.

Applicant must possess asecondaryCalifornia state teaching certification in the subject area in addition to a computer with the appropriate Internet connectivity and software. All California Aventa Teachers must meet NCLB Highly Qualified requirements for the state of California.
Specific Responsibilities:
The Teacher will teach courses following a proactive instructional methodology, such as:
* Contact each new student to welcome them to the course.
* Contact each new mentor to introduce yourself and provide any additional information about course requirements/expectations.
* Contact individual students who are inactive for a period of 3 or more days.
* Contact the mentor if a student is inactive for a period of 5 days or more.
* Closely monitor student progress relative to their individual course schedule.
* Monitor end dates to ensure students are staying on track in the course, and proactively contact the student and mentor if concerns arise or if an extension is recommended.
* Provide motivating, timely, and constructive feedback for student assignments.
* Provide motivating comments and constructive feedback for each assessment item.
* Evaluate all subjective assessments (homework assignments as well as subjective exam components) and assign an appropriate grade to each within three days of student submission.
* Ensure that final grades are issued in a timely manner when a student completes a course, within 5 days of when the student's last assignment was submitted or when their end date has passed.
* Communicate effectively with students and mentors at different technology skill levels to support instruction and advance educational goals.
* Hold regularly scheduled office hours each week (minimum 1 hour session each week) via Elluminate and ensure that students unable to attend these sessions have access to recorded meetings.
* Provide useful information to students to support success in each course by updating the course home/syllabus area in each course section at a minimum to ensure that it includes a complete syllabus, an explanation of course policies, grading policies, staff information, contact information, and other appropriate information needed as students take the course.
* Respond to student and mentor inquiries, questions and requests for help within one day of receipt, regardless of the medium (email, phone call, etc.)
* Demonstrate the proper and proficient distribution of announcements and updating these regularly (at least monthly) so that enrolling students feel welcomed and part of the course throughout.
* Manage and communicate effectively via the telephone, email, and the Message Center.
* Demonstrate the proper use of voice mail (if applicable).
* Manage and communicate effectively via the discussion board.
* Demonstrate the proper use of the discussion board, create forums, ensure students stay on topic, and maintain a collaborative environment.
* Demonstrate sufficient use of a Web browser and search engine to locate and evaluate technology-based educational sites that support the instruction and enhance interactivity. Demonstrate proficient distribution of websites.
* Work with other staff and faculty in a cooperative, professional atmosphere, including
* Effectively review courses on an as-needed basis to ensure accurate and current content/assessments.
* Collaborate with staff, teachers and/or course writers on an as-needed basis in order to enhance the curriculum.
* Actively monitor and participate in the Online Instruction Community forum/discussion group for Aventa Learning teachers and others teaching Aventa Learning courses.
* Serve as a mentor to other teachers teaching Aventa Learning courses (if applicable).
* Participate in faculty meetings, hardware, software and/or educational training sessions as scheduled.
* Provide at least two weeks notice before taking any vacation consisting of three or more days off.
* Keep accurate, organized records.
* Maintain and develop educationally sound rubrics and apply them to the grading process.
* Demonstrate ability to record and submit timesheet on a regularly scheduled basis.
* Pursue professional development opportunities.
* Satisfy all continuing educational requirements as dictated by state teaching certification.
* Attend summer institutes sponsored by The College Board (AP teachers only). These part time positions pay $12.00 / hour and work up to 30 hours/ week (depending on assigned work load)
